| biography:
| Physicist, born in Great Falls (later North Gorham), Maine, USA. He discovered the electromagnetic potential difference of conductors, now known as the Hall effect, while a graduate student at Johns Hopkins (1879). He continued his thermoelectric research at Harvard (1881–1921), where he also wrote many physics textbooks and laboratory manuals. |
